Software Engineer | London, Hybrid
Our client is a global investment manager with a strong heritage in active investment and technology-led innovation. The firm operates across multiple asset classes, including global FX, derivatives, and multi-asset portfolios.
Technology plays a central role in shaping investment decisions, supporting trading execution, and enabling scalable, data-driven investment solutions.
The organisation is seeking a Full Stack Developer to join its Front Office Technology group, contributing to the development of high-quality trading and analytics platforms used across the investment desks.

The Role
As a Full Stack Developer, you will work alongside investment teams, traders, quantitative analysts, and technology specialists to build robust, modern software solutions that enhance the firm’s FX and derivatives execution workflows.
This includes designing front-to-back tools, building real-time data services, and supporting key front office functions such as pricing, execution, and portfolio insights.
The role is ideal for an engineer who is passionate about high‑quality software and enjoys working in close partnership with the business.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and enhance full-stack applications supporting the firm’s FX, eFX, and derivatives trading activity.
- Design backend services using C#, .NET, SQL, and Python for analytics, automation, and data processing.
- Build trader- and portfolio manager-facing tools, dashboards, and interfaces.
- Implement event-driven patterns and streaming services using Kafka.
- Develop cloud-ready components and services within AWS (preferred) or similar environments.
- Contribute to DevOps processes using Azure DevOps, Git, and Docker for CI/CD and environment management.
- Collaborate closely with Front Office teams to gather requirements and deliver effective, user-centric solutions.
- Ensure system resilience, scalability, and performance across the full application lifecycle.
Required Skills & Experience
- 4–5+ years of proven full stack development experience.
- Advanced proficiency with C# / .NET for backend engineering.
- Strong experience with SQL and database architecture.
- Practical experience using Python for tools, automation, or analysis.
- Understanding of Kafka or comparable streaming/messaging technologies.
- Experience building and deploying within AWS cloud environments.
- Familiarity with Azure DevOps, Git workflows, and Docker containers.
- Background in financial services, ideally within asset management, investment technology, trading, or derivatives.
- Strong communication skills and ability to work closely with investment teams.
Desirable Qualifications
- A PhD or MSc in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, Physics, or a related quantitative discipline.
Experience with:
- Front office applications or order/execution workflows
- Market data and real‑time systems
- FX, derivatives, or multi‑asset investment processes
